Transaction 80fd2b8992a1986aa68563cd30fa0becd32ab581f8e7afc33276e0b76b81bde0
1 Input
1 Output
-
80fd2b8992a1986aa68563cd30fa0becd32ab581f8e7afc33276e0b76b81bde0:0
- value
- 1573774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af7c79184f09f5ebab4c2d32cadf219c025e6e99 OP_EQUAL
- address
- 3HguHekKMp7ediDCayngRWfpiocCLj9JZv